Wikitude Drive is the world's first mobile navigation app using fun and intuitive Augmented Reality to guide the driver along a line drawn onto reality. Wikitude Drive has two great advantages: 1. No need to read maps - just follow a line. 2. See the live video of what's ahead of you and therefore never take your eyes off the road again. Use it in car or pedestrian mode. Wikitude Drive won international Awards including den "Global Champion Award" of the Navteq Challenge 2010 and the "Galileo Award" at the European Satellite Navigation Competition 2010.
